On Tue, Mar 16, 2021 at 01:45:51PM +0200, Andy Shevchenko wrote:
On Mon, Mar 15, 2021 at 06:54:24PM -0700, Yury Norov wrote:
Add myself as maintainer for bitmap API and Andy and Rasmus as reviewers.

I'm an author of current implementation of lib/find_bit and an active
contributor to lib/bitmap. It was spotted that there's no maintainer for
bitmap API. I'm willing to maintain it.

Does this file exist?
I guess checkpatch.pl nowadays has a MAINTAINER data base validation.

No lib/find_find_bit_benchmark.c doesn't exist. It's a typo, it should
be lib/find_bit_benchmark.c. Checkpatch doesn't warn:

yury:linux$ scripts/checkpatch.pl 0013-MAINTAINERS-Add-entry-for-the-bitmap-API.patch
total: 0 errors, 0 warnings, 22 lines checked
